Yes: The length of the luteal phase really depends upon whether or not progesterone is being produced by the ovary after ovulation. Adding progesterone as a medication after ovulation may prolong the luteal phase. However, metabolism is different for different women and the lengthening of the luteal phase may be dose related. Remember that Provera (medroxyprogesterone) is not progesterone.
